Buying Guide: Key Considerations For Selecting Twin Halloween Costumes
Choosing the right twin costumes for adults involves balancing comfort, appearance, and practicality. Consider fit and sizing first—adult-friendly options with soft fabrics and adjustable elements typically perform better during long events. Coordinate with your partner on a theme to ensure the outfits feel cohesive, whether you want cute, spooky, or humorous results. Quantity and components matter: some sets come with multiple accessories, while others require separate purchases. Visibility and mobility are important for crowds and dance floors, so avoid heavy costumes if you’ll be moving a lot. Finally, reusable materials add value for future celebrations.

Practical Tips For Twin Costumes
Plan ahead by laying out all components and trying on outfits before the event. Ensure accessories stay secure during movement and photos. If costumes rely on makeup or wigs, test them in advance to avoid skin irritation and ensure comfortable wear. For performance or contest scenarios, rehearse quick changes or pose poses that highlight the twin bond. Finally, consider emergency basics—extra socks, tape, or safety pins—to handle minor wardrobe malfunctions swiftly.
